Surteco Group SE (SUR) - Total Assets
Based on the latest financial reports, Surteco Group SE (SUR) holds total assets worth €944.03 Million EUR (≈ $1.10 Billion USD) as of March 2026. Total assets represent everything the company owns and controls, combining both current assets—like cash and cash equivalents, accounts receivable, and inventories—and non-current assets such as property, plant, equipment (PP&E), intangible assets, and long-term investments. Annual Total Assets for Surteco Group SE (2006–2025)
The table below shows the annual total assets of Surteco Group SE from 2006 to 2025.
| Year | Total Assets |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2025-12-31 | €948.73 Million ≈ $1.11 Billion |
-6.29% |
| 2024-12-31 | €1.01 Billion ≈ $1.18 Billion |
-2.82% |
| 2023-12-31 | €1.04 Billion ≈ $1.22 Billion |
+22.30% |
| 2022-12-31 | €851.86 Million ≈ $995.91 Million |
+7.13% |
| 2021-12-31 | €795.15 Million ≈ $929.61 Million |
-0.45% |
| 2020-12-31 | €798.78 Million ≈ $933.85 Million |
+2.36% |
| 2019-12-31 | €780.33 Million ≈ $912.28 Million |
-7.60% |
| 2018-12-31 | €844.54 Million ≈ $987.36 Million |
+0.23% |
| 2017-12-31 | €842.60 Million ≈ $985.08 Million |
+25.04% |
| 2016-12-31 | €673.87 Million ≈ $787.82 Million |
+2.70% |
| 2015-12-31 | €656.13 Million ≈ $767.08 Million |
+3.06% |
| 2014-12-31 | €636.67 Million ≈ $744.33 Million |
+1.63% |
| 2013-12-31 | €626.47 Million ≈ $732.41 Million |
+34.08% |
| 2012-12-31 | €467.25 Million ≈ $546.26 Million |
-2.86% |
| 2011-12-31 | €481.00 Million ≈ $562.33 Million |
-0.11% |
| 2010-12-31 | €481.54 Million ≈ $562.98 Million |
-0.03% |
| 2009-12-31 | €481.68 Million ≈ $563.13 Million |
-1.71% |
| 2008-12-31 | €490.07 Million ≈ $572.95 Million |
-4.80% |
| 2007-12-31 | €514.78 Million ≈ $601.83 Million |
+37.94% |
| 2006-12-31 | €373.20 Million ≈ $436.31 Million |
-- |
About Surteco Group SE
Surteco Group SE engages in the development, production, and sale of coated surface materials based on paper and plastic in Germany, rest of Europe, the United States, Asia, Australia, and internationally.
